Addition of Image Processing Method
Click ”+” button to show the list of image processing methods
which are usable within the processing group. The selected
method will be added at the end of the group.
Group
Method Name
Description
ImageFilter
MeanImage
Average images by mean value
Sobel
Acquire Sobel image as the primary
differential value,
Laplace
Acquire Laplace image as the secondary
differential value,
Gaussian
Process linear convolution by Gaussian
mask
DilationImage
Dilate images
ErosionImage
Erode images
MedianImage
Average images by median value
ThresholdTruncation
Change value over threshold to threshold
value
ThresholdToZero
Change value under threshold to
“0”
AddImage
Add images
AddSImage
Add defined value to images
SubImage
Subtract images
SubSImage
Subtract defined value from images
MulImage
Multiply images
MulSImage
Multiply images by defined value
DivImage
Divide images
DivSImage
Divide images by defined value
Binarization
Threshold
Binarize all images with the same
threshold
ThresholdOtsu
Binarize all images with a fixed threshold
calculated by Otu
’s method.
AdaptiveThreshold
Binarize images with variable threshold
according to image location
ThresholdSigma
Binarize images with fixed threshold
calculated from the standard deviation of
background image
AdaptiveSigmaThresh
old
Binarize with dynamic thresholds
calculated from the standard deviation of
background image
BinarizeTransform
DilationCircle
Dilate binarized region in a circular shape
DilationRectangle
Dilate binarized reign in a rectangular
shape
ErosionCircle
Erode binarized region in a circular shape
ErosionRectangle
Erode binarized region in a rectangular
shape
ClosingCircle
Close circularly dilated binarized region
ClosingRectangle
Close rectangular dilated binarized region
OpeningCircle
Open circularly eroded binarized region
OpeningRectangle
Open rectangular eroded binarized region
FindMaximumDistance
Obtain maximum metric value of from
background
FindMaximumImage
Obtain maxmal value in binalized region
OrImage
Obtain union of two binarized regions
Skeleton3D
Extract center line of binarized region
Pruning3D
Remove branches of extracted center line
AndImage
Obtain cross union of two binarized
regions
XorImage
Obtain symmetric difference set of two
binarized regions
